MEMO — Dispatch Desk. Subject: Weekly backup tape rotation. The off-site backup tapes for the Ardenfell cluster are packed in the usual lockbox and ready at the IT cage. A courier from Stonebriar Secure Transit will collect them Thursday at noon for transfer to the Welkin Vault facility. Tapes must remain in the lockbox at all times and may not be combined with other shipments. At collection, the courier is to receive this instruction:

handover note for yagef-bagep: the drudor pelius courier leaves the kasdor zorvan norir ledger at gate 8016 under passcode 755406

FAQ — stringharvest extraction script

Q: What does stringharvest actually touch?

A: The script scans the Norvale app repo for translatable strings, writes them to a catalog file, and pushes it to the Lintmere translation queue. It runs read-only against source code; the only write targets are the catalog directory and the queue endpoint. Credentials come from the sealed config bundle, nothing in env vars. Security reviewers should note: unsealing that bundle on a new runner requires entering the recovery passphrase.

unlock words, tawif-tahop: oliys-ulawyn-tamdor-lamys-casox-jormir-fraius-kasath-ulador-ulamir-holir-sorys-holeth

## Account Recovery — Trailnote Offline Mode

When a surveyor's Trailnote app has been offline for 30+ days, their local credentials expire and sync refuses to resume. Don't make them wipe the device — all their unsynced field data lives there! Instead, open the support console, pick "Offline Reinstate," and enter their handle. The console will ask for the support team's shared recovery passphrase before issuing a reinstatement token. Use the one below.

unlock words, bagaf-fajeg: zorael-kelax-fraath-quenix-eliok-sileth-aldmir-wenir-druiel

## Onboarding: Lintbird Component Library Versioning

Support staff should know Lintbird follows strict semver: majors break props, minors add components, patches fix rendering only. Customers on pinned majors get fixes backported for six months. When escalating version-mismatch tickets, always capture the lockfile. Access to the internal release archive requires unlocking the support vault with the recovery passphrase below.

vault phrase of tawig-taduf = zorath-oliwyn